Transaction 31e2189cf6758333579b73b99db6f1387e39ee4c4fb3ff09a47d45ada55d86d2

2 Input
2 Outputs
  • 31e2189cf6758333579b73b99db6f1387e39ee4c4fb3ff09a47d45ada55d86d2:0
  • value  12877114
    address  33AQiNmEUFjUXFH8JzoRNf9KYWfsdT5rea
  • 31e2189cf6758333579b73b99db6f1387e39ee4c4fb3ff09a47d45ada55d86d2:1
  • value  1060523
    address  3PNxjrbbXjGXdknEnUHX4XAZB2wgrjMRiG